Hot water is an essential component in our daily lives, whether it be for bathing, cooking, or cleaning In order to ensure a steady supply of hot water, many households rely on hot water tanks These tanks store and heat water to be used whenever needed However, in order for a hot water tank to function properly, it is crucial to monitor and regulate the temperature inside the tank This is where temperature sensors come into play.
A temperature sensor in a hot water tank is a small but powerful device that measures the temperature of the water inside the tank This information is then relayed to a control unit which can adjust the heating element accordingly to maintain the desired temperature There are several reasons why temperature sensors are essential in hot water tanks.
First and foremost, temperature sensors help prevent overheating of the water in the tank If the water temperature exceeds a certain level, it can not only waste energy but also pose a safety hazard In extreme cases, overheating can lead to the tank exploding, causing significant damage to the property and endangering the residents By constantly monitoring the temperature, sensors can prevent such disasters from happening.

Moreover, temperature sensors play a crucial role in energy efficiency By accurately measuring the temperature of the water, sensors help the heating element operate more efficiently This means that the hot water tank consumes less energy to maintain the desired temperature, leading to cost savings for the household and reducing the overall carbon footprint.
In addition, temperature sensors also contribute to the longevity of the hot water tank By preventing overheating and ensuring optimal temperature levels, sensors reduce the wear and tear on the heating element and other components of the tank This can extend the lifespan of the hot water tank, saving the homeowner from costly repairs or replacements in the long run.
Furthermore, temperature sensors provide valuable data for maintenance and troubleshooting purposes By recording and analyzing temperature trends over time, technicians can identify potential issues before they escalate into major problems This proactive approach to maintenance can prevent unexpected breakdowns and ensure that the hot water tank operates smoothly for years to come.
